Bourbeuse Valley Harley-Davidson in Villa Ridge, Missouri has announced that it will cease operations on March 30th of this year.
Four miles from my house and very rural on a stretch of Old Route 66.
A family-owned business, they bought a small Honda/Yamaha dealership in the early 80's. Later, they added Harley.
Sometime around 2003, I think - they built a new, very much larger building and then went strictly Harley. I remember that they were always fair, and that they went out of their way to help stranded motorcyclists and get them back on the road, and they donated heavily to the local fundraisers.
They made up a little video to convey that they weren't forced, nor were they broke, but that it was "just time".
Both of them pushing 80 may have been a contributing factor.
